    I had not got around to this game as life gets in the way. One of my buddies bought it over years ago but I didn't want to play until I had a copy.

    Anyway I have recently done a Gta 3 - San andreas run and saw this on sale for $25 for the HD xbox one version so grabbed it.

    Well I was not dissapointed, after GTA4 which had its moments but was a bit dissapointing, this one gets it bang on.

    The graphics still look good today, and the story is packed full of greatness. Clowning around doing random stuff is fun and in the sub mission I saw a whale and was mind blown.

    As far as downsides, the game does feel a little small, I know the map is bigger than San andreas but it doesn't feel so. I get the impression that Rockstar saw how much money they were making from gta online and scrapped planned DLC, just a hunch.

    No San fierro, no Las venturas? These could have been DLC expansions for SURE.

    Only other complaint, I would have liked more "hood" missions as Franklin. You do a couple and then he's hanging out with old guys and leaves the hood, I would have liked a few more missions there for some variety with his character, he has the ghetto, Michael the fancy area and Trevor the hillbilly area.
